Fort Dream Meaning & Interpretation
Dreaming of a fort generally signifies your inner sense of protection and security. A fort, in the context of dreams, represents not only physical barriers but also emotional ones. It embodies the values of strength, resilience, and the necessity to create safe spaces in your life. As you navigate various challenges, your subconscious might build a metaphorical fort to help you process these experiences, reflecting your desire to defend your emotional well-being against perceived attackers, such as stress or fears. Similar symbols like a Fortress or a Tower also convey themes of defense and safeguarding what is important to you, emphasizing your need for stability and safety.
When you dream of defending a fort, it often indicates a vigilant attitude towards your waking life circumstances. You may be facing overwhelming responsibilities or pressures that provoke a natural defensive response. This could manifest as a need to protect your sense of self, whether in professional, social, or personal contexts. The need for vigilance may suggest feelings of anxiety, hinting that you could be hyper-aware of potential threats or conflicts, thus reinforcing your instinct to remain cautious and prepared for unforeseen challenges. In this way, the fort serves as a stronghold, much like a Titan standing firm against adversity.
In contrast, if your dream features your fort under siege, this scenario can take on a more poignant meaning. Such dreams may reveal inner turmoil, showcasing how external stressors can overwhelm your defenses. A siege can symbolize the pressures you feel in real life, whether from relationships, work, or personal challenges. This imagery might also highlight feelings of vulnerability—an acknowledgment that despite your best efforts to fortify your emotional defenses, external factors are creating an internal crisis, urging you to explore these feelings and confront them head-on.
The emotional context of the dream plays a vital role in understanding its implications. If in the dream you feel calm and collected while defending your fort, this might suggest an overall sense of empowerment and readiness to tackle life’s challenges. Conversely, feelings of panic or helplessness during the dream indicate a sense of being overwhelmed, emphasizing the need for support or coping strategies in your waking life. Acknowledging these emotions can be the first step toward developing healthier ways to manage stress and adversity. Sometimes, noticing a Flag flying over a fort in your dream can symbolize your personal identity or values standing proudly amid challenges.
From a psychological perspective, dreaming of a fort reflects your subconscious efforts to create both physical and emotional boundaries. This symbol can reveal underlying anxieties or unresolved issues that need addressing. A fort can serve as a shell, protecting your true self from outside influences while hinting at a fear of intimacy or vulnerability. Recognizing your tendencies to isolate or defend yourself can offer insights into your personal growth journey, inspiring an exploration of what it means to let down your guard at the right moments.
Culturally, forts have often been associated with survival and community. Historical contexts can manifest in dreams as symbols of familial or societal ties. If your dream features a fort steeped in memories, it might reflect the values and teachings that shaped your view of security and protection. Understanding these cultural significances can provide a broader view of how your experiences and heritage influence your emotional landscape, allowing you a richer context for interpreting your dreams.
